Latest Patents

One of Takeuchi's latest patents is the deformed nail corrector. This device is designed to correct deformed nails and includes a first elastic wire fixed to one edge of the nail and a second elastic wire fixed to the opposite edge. These wires are bound together by a binding means, allowing them to deform along the nail for effective correction. Another significant patent is the intravascular obstruction removing wire and medical instrument. This invention features an elongate wire body with non-branched wire portions and filament portions that form a trapping mechanism. This mechanism can transition between a large-diameter state for trapping obstructions in blood vessels and a small-diameter state for removal.
